CVE-2026-73659: CWE-22: Improper Limitation of a Pathname to a Restricted Directory ('Path Traversal') in triggerdotdev trigger.devCVE-2026-73659 0 Trigger.dev versions from 4.4.2 up to but not including 4.5.0 contain a path traversal vulnerability in the packet presign routes. This flaw allows a caller-controlled filename to escape the intended restricted directory, enabling unauthorized read or overwrite access to other organizations' offloaded task payloads and outputs in multi-organization self-hosted instances. CVE-2026-73658: CWE-20: Improper Input Validation in triggerdotdev trigger.devCVE-2026-73658 0 CVE-2026-73658 is a high-severity vulnerability in trigger.dev, a platform for building and deploying AI agents and workflows. Versions from 4.4.2 up to but not including 4.5.0-rc.5 contain improper input validation in the Aws4FetchClient component, allowing user-controlled packet keys to be assigned to URL pathnames without proper normalization and ownership checks. This flaw enables an attacker with a valid environment API key to obtain presigned URLs for other tenants' object-store keys, potentially reading or overwriting task payloads. The issue is fixed starting from version 4.5.0-rc.5. The vulnerability has a CVSS score of 8.2, indicating high impact on confidentiality and integrity but no impact on availability. CVE-2026-73657: CWE-22: Improper Limitation of a Pathname to a Restricted Directory ('Path Traversal') in triggerdotdev trigger.devCVE-2026-73657 0 Trigger.dev versions from 4.4.2 up to but not including 4.5.0-rc.4 contain a path traversal vulnerability and improper access control in the replay API endpoint. This allows any valid environment API key to replay another tenant's run by friendlyId, potentially consuming victim resources and repeating side effects. Additionally, when using a specific payload type, an attacker can overwrite payload bytes via a separate object-store path traversal, injecting attacker-controlled input into the victim's task. CVE-2026-73656: CWE-639: Authorization Bypass Through User-Controlled Key in triggerdotdev trigger.devCVE-2026-73656 0 Trigger.dev versions prior to 4.5.6 contain an authorization bypass vulnerability in the background worker deployment API. The flaw allows a user with a valid API key for one project to manipulate another project's deployment by linking an attacker-owned background worker to the victim deployment and changing its state from BUILDING to DEPLOYING. CVE-2026-73655: CWE-287: Improper Authentication in triggerdotdev trigger.devCVE-2026-73655 0 Trigger.dev versions prior to 4.5.2 contain an improper authentication vulnerability in the Google authentication flow. The vulnerability allows an attacker to link an unverified Google email profile to an existing account with the same email, potentially taking over that account. CVE-2026-73654: CWE-1321: Improperly Controlled Modification of Object Prototype Attributes ('Prototype Pollution') in triggerdotdev trigger.devCVE-2026-73654 0 Trigger.dev versions prior to 4.5.6 contain a prototype pollution vulnerability in the PUT /api/v1/runs/:runId/metadata endpoint. This flaw allows an attacker with a normal environment API key to modify Object.prototype in the shared webapp process, leading to corruption of Prisma queries and Prometheus labels, breaking worker authentication for other tenants, and causing a process-wide denial of service.
